The dark business of animal trafficking: marmosets as victims 1. Introduction Illegal animal trafficking is one of the most lucrative illicit activities in the world, second only to drug, arms and human trafficking. Each year, this business moves between 7 and 23 billion dollars, according to estimates by international organisations. [...]
